The Thermal Cost of Remote Work: How Poor Attic Ventilation Threatens Teaneck Home Offices and Roof Lifespans

As remote work cements itself as a permanent fixture for Teaneck professionals, many homeowners are converting attic spaces and upper floors into dedicated home offices, unknowingly putting unprecedented thermal stress on their properties. Adding continuous human occupancy, multiple monitors, high-powered computers, and task lighting to an upper level significantly increases localized heat loads. In Bergen County's humid summers and cold winters, these tech-heavy workspaces require a delicate balance of climate control and attic ventilation that standard residential construction was rarely designed to handle.

Attic ventilation is a critical system that directly impacts both energy efficiency and structural longevity. According to local building inspection data, improper attic ventilation is one of the most common issues found in Bergen County homes, many of which are on their second or third roof. When a home office is built into an upper story without proper ventilation pathways, trapped heat can climb significantly during the summer, baking roofing shingles from the inside out and dramatically shortening their lifespan. In the winter, this same trapped heat melts snow on the roof surface, which then refreezes at the cold eaves, causing destructive ice damming.

Homeowners often try to compensate for a sweltering upper-floor workspace by running portable air conditioners or installing DIY exhaust fans. However, local engineering assessments warn that temporary patches often worsen the problem. Drawing air rapidly out of an unsealed attic can create negative pressure, pulling conditioned air out of the living spaces below or drawing damp, humid air into the home's wall cavities. Delaying a professional evaluation of the roof's ventilation system can turn a localized comfort issue into a major structural failure, leading to mold growth, rotted roof decking, and the eventually accelerated need for a costly full roof replacement.

Evaluating the system before the transition to autumn is crucial. Homeowners should consider scheduling a professional home energy audit. Utilizing advanced diagnostic technologies, such as thermal imaging cameras, a certified auditor can pinpoint exact areas of heat loss, air infiltration, and thermal bridging in the attic space. Solutions often involve installing automated, temperature-sensitive smart baffles, ensuring soffit vents are free of insulation debris, or upgrading to a balanced ridge-and-soffit ventilation system. Consulting with a licensed roofing or HVAC contractor ensures that home office upgrades do not compromise the home's envelope or the longevity of the roof structure.
